The Department of Civil, Construction, and Environmental Engineering is where tradition meets the future! The University of Alabama's civil engineering program is one of the oldest in country with a long history of preparing future leaders in the profession. Our civil, construction, and environmental engineering programs are focused on developing the knowledge, skills, and attitudes necessary for success in the future, your future.

We share the American Society of Civil Engineers (ASCE) vision of the future, where our graduates are entrusted by society to create a sustainable world and enhance the global quality of life. Along with others, civil, construction, and environmental engineers will serve competently, collaboratively, and ethically as master planners, designers, constructors, and operators of the built environment; as master stewards of the natural environment; as master innovators and integrators of ideas and technology; as master managers of risk and uncertainty; and as master leaders in shaping policy.
